Visible Gemini labels are different from SynthID
This editor can replace visible pixels that form a label or overlay. It cannot remove SynthID or other signals that are not simply visible text in the image, and it does not change where the image came from.
Inpainting uses nearby color, texture, lighting, and structure to generate a plausible fill. A small corner label on a simple background is easier than a large mark crossing a face, detailed object, or important typography.
Use an official clean export when one is available. After any authorized edit, keep the source record and follow Google terms, required attribution, and applicable AI-content disclosure rules.

Does this remove SynthID?
No. It edits visible pixels only and does not remove SynthID, metadata, provenance, or AI-detection signals.
Does every Gemini image have a visible watermark?
No. Visible watermark availability depends on Gemini settings, account, region, and product surface; invisible SynthID remains separate.
